After failing to score in their last match, Hawthorne Math & Science Academy made sure to put some goals up on the board against Southlands Christian on Friday. They were the clear victor by a 4-1 margin over the Southlands Christian Eagles. The result was nothing new for the The Aviators , who have now won six contests by three goals or more so far this season.
They hit Southlands Christian with a four-pronged attack, as the team got scores from Adam Osmali, Jesus Martinez, Bryan Lezama, and Gavin Bontemps.
With the victory, Hawthorne Math & Science Academy broke their three-game losing streak and moved their record to 7-3. As for Southlands Christian, they are on a three-game losing streak that has dropped them down to 1-8.
Hawthorne Math & Science Academy has already played their next game, a 5-2 defeat against Schurr on the 28th. As for Southlands Christian, they also wasted no time getting back out on the pitch and have already played their next match, a 1-0 loss against Whittier on the 28th.
